What Engine Does the Game REPO Use?

Have you ever wondered what makes the game REPO tick? It's a question that pops up a lot, and the short answer is that REPO runs on the Unity engine. This might not mean much to you if you're not a game developer, but it's a pretty big deal in the world of video games.

Unity is one of the most popular game engines out there, and for good reason. It’s known for being versatile and relatively easy to use, which is why so many indie developers choose it for their projects. I remember when I first started messing around with game development, Unity was the first engine I tried. It was still complicated, but it was a lot more user-friendly than some of the other options. For a game like REPO, which has a unique concept and was developed by a small team, Unity was the perfect choice. It allowed the developers to focus on the creative aspects of the game without getting bogged down in the technical details.
